Noether Symmetries in Quantum Cosmology: A Selection Rule for Observable Universes

  • Salvatore Capozziello

摘要

Noether’s symmetries play a prominent role in any branch of physics. Here, we discuss their role in Quantum Cosmology. In particular, in this Chapter, we consider minisuperspace cosmological models, showing that the existence of symmetries, and then conserved quantities, not only allows to obtain exact cosmological solutions but also gives a selection rule through which one can recover correlations among cosmological parameters, that is a criterion to select observable universes. In this sense, symmetries are related to physically reliable models. Examples are worked out starting from some theories of gravity.
